Transaction efca79fe2a25dbec15f750ff31424e3b0d09fba86dc8b8de60a594be9e7de199

1 Input
2 Outputs
  • efca79fe2a25dbec15f750ff31424e3b0d09fba86dc8b8de60a594be9e7de199:0
  • value  480458
    address  3JXrSCbYZMpAEh3ZBUshFQD4GafSZtBUsK
  • efca79fe2a25dbec15f750ff31424e3b0d09fba86dc8b8de60a594be9e7de199:1
  • value  3450038
    address  3QpmD9oQCd3RSMDkiWCDyzBAV8XdQH5jus